16. I'm not seeing results after 30 days, what am I doing wrong?

Have some Patience - As I stated before, most people quit after the first month - I know this because I've seen it on our P90X forums. They get frustrated because they diet and workout very hard for 30 days after years of neglecting their body!?? Come on people! You must have some patience! I see the first 30 days as the "adjusting" period. Your body is in "shock" mode. Some people start to get good results after 30 days, some don't change at all...it really depends on the person. I started to see significant results 2 weeks after the second month. Once you past the 30 days mark, this is when you need to kick it up and really push yourself hard.

17. I'm gaining weight, what's wrong!

This may happen to you in the first 30 days. Like I posted earlier, the first 30 days your body is in shock mode. The second month is when you'll start to lose weight.

The great thing about this whole experience is that Beachbody, the company that sells P90X gives you so many different tools. First off with the program you get a complete work out guide and DVDs, then you get the meal planner which tells you exactly what you need to eat, or if you don't want that, it just tells you what size portions to eat and lets you choose. Then they have the online WOWY.com which lets you start your work out online, keep track of them and even see who else is doing the workouts at the same time, you can even chat after your done. Finally are the free message boards they have that let you connect with everyone else doing P90X some people are repeating it for the 11th or 12th time!! You get to learn from all of them, and see all of their progress to motivate you.

From the message boards I learned about another neat tool that lets you track your daily calorie intake (and quite a bit more) rather easy. It is at FitDay.Com. You just enter what food you ate and it will give you cool graphs that keep track of caloric intake, vitamins, etc. A neat tool to visualize how much food you eat. For example Pam is on a 1800 calorie per day diet... If you think that number is high, ie that it is a lot of calories to be eating in a day, and you are overweight, then you need log every calorie you eat for a week... Most people that are over weight are eating more in the range of 2500-2800 calories a day and don't even realize it, so this really helps you learn where your calories come from and see how they all add up.

Now the recovery drink that Pam and I got is not the official P90X drink, but the key is the 4 to 1 carbs to protein ratio. So we found this stuff called Accelerade which is a little cheaper then the official one and are using it. I kinda like it because to get the same amount of carbs and protein as the official drink we have to drink 24 oz instead of 12 oz. So we end up drinking half of our recovery drink during the work out and half after it plus a protein bar (I talked about those in an earlier post mmm Muscle Milk protein bars or Cliff Builders Bars... both yummy!)
